Proverbs 14:8 - New Revised Standard Version Updated Edition 2021 It is the wisdom of the clever to understand where they go, but the folly of fools misleads. More versionsKing James Version (Oxford) 1769 The wisdom of the prudent is to understand his way: But the folly of fools is deceit. Amplified Bible - Classic Edition The Wisdom [godly Wisdom, which is comprehensive insight into the ways and purposes of God] of the prudent is to understand his way, but the folly of [self-confident] fools is to deceive. American Standard Version (1901) The wisdom of the prudent is to understand his way; But the folly of fools is deceit. Common English Bible By their wisdom the prudent understand their way, but the stupidity of fools deceives them. Catholic Public Domain Version The wisdom of a discerning man is to understand his way. And the imprudence of the foolish is to be wandering astray. Douay-Rheims version of The Bible - 1752 version The wisdom of a discreet man is to understand his way: and the imprudence of fools erreth. |
